🇨🇦 Est. 2007

Related products
-
XPR300 – 124015
Contact For Pricing -
XPR300 – 10079383
Contact For Pricing -
XPR300 – 124003
Contact For Pricing -
XPR300 – 124011
Contact For Pricing -
XPR300 – 11110
Contact For Pricing -
XPR300 – 124007
Contact For Pricing -
XPR300 – 124017
Contact For Pricing -
XPR300 – 124008
Contact For Pricing